Output 02638dac64a3fec681b3ff561b46504db6ab7cc437927e0c2077b125970e09c4:0

value
764686
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59ba9858154159d5fe5af4a1327b3bbbc275e403 OP_EQUAL
address
39sTbUGyr5rz78idfJtovTKCVz5ULb5Hq4
transaction
02638dac64a3fec681b3ff561b46504db6ab7cc437927e0c2077b125970e09c4
spent
true